1.what system do you use vodka,zeo,biopellets etc...

I used a method most others do not use, i dose Vodka only 3 days a week, i also am dosing Elo's aminos at 2 drops a day, Phol's xtra at 2ml per day and 9 drops of Elo's pro skimmer a day

So far i've only been doing the Elos pro skimmer and pohls xtra for a week, so far i have noticed a difference, though i think the phol's xtra is a mix of vinegar and amino's which IMO is the same as me dosing the Vodka and aminos, but i have seen an improvement in deeper color with adding it at only 2ml per day which is only a 50g dose i don't think it is something i'd ever dose the full amount of because with the Vodka and aminos i'm already adding i would hate for them to conflict each other but so far so good

2.does it work?
IMO yes it does work, so far i've noticed better growth/PE and a lot better color


3.what skimmer are you using ?
MSX160 with Red demon pinwheel and Valute intake mod, this skimmer IMO is perfectly rated for my tank, not too small and not oversized, i get a full cup of skimate every week


4.what lighting do you use metal halide,t5's or led's
i used 20 PAR38 led spotlights

4 20k with 40 optics
8 12k's with 40 optics
4 all royal blue with 60 optics
4 custom 4 cool blue 1 neutral white with 60 optics

So far from what i've learned i will be switching out some of the cool white leds in the 12k bulbs for more royal blue and neutral white, This IMO is the only thing holding back color on my sps


5.and what size tank is this all happening on?
200g marineland DD with a 40g sump
 
1.what system do you use vodka,zeo,biopellets etc...
I am currently using Brightwells NeoZeo..This included the rocks in next reef reactor, Bio-fuel, MB7 and a couple other Brightwell additives

2.does it work?
I have mixed reviews of this, on one hand it does work I have undetectable PO4 or nitrates. Growth on my sps is pretty stellar water is crystal clear all the time. On the other hand its dose make "most" of your corals look a lot lighter, I have RPE's that turned a light pink color and a digi that turned completely white but is still alive and has polyps (weird). Also not sure if it was cause of this method but I got a lot of brown slime on everything people say it just comes with using this method. I just recently took the rocks offline and the RPE's have gotten their color back, but the digi still looks albino. I guess I am just not a fan how it makes your corals look.

3.what skimmer are you using ?
SWC xtreme 160 modified with Sicce PSK 2500 pump with red devil needle wheel

4.what lighting do you use metal halide,t5's or led's
Ati Sunpower 6x39

5.and what size tank is this all happening on?
50 Gallons

Right now I am continuing to use the Brightwell products without the rocks and see what kinda of results I have. As for other dosing I just use B-Ionic 2 part and Mag.

1. I did dose vodka, half recommended dose
2. For me no, it made things worse. Cyano bloom, pale colors lost my Aussi Acan and ****ed my xenia off. I feed more while dosing but it did not help with colors.
3. Octopus NW110 modded
4. 250 watt 20k MH
5. 40 breeder 50 gallons total system.
Now I still heavy heavy, have 0 no3 and po4 and getting great growth and colors are looking good. I also dose kalk and AAs along with feeding the fish and sps.

No issues with Cyano when I was on Zeo. I had decided to kick Zeo bcuz it was just difficult to get and I was spending an arm and a leg on shipping, let alone the Zeo additives itself.

I noticed cyano after I had been off of Zeo. This is what led me to follow the MB7+Vodka Method. Since then I've siphoned out as much cyano as possible and started the 2 week MB7 seeding process. Bacteria took over and starved the cyano (I'm guessing) as I no longer have it in my DT.
